#VU11317 Code injection in Drupal


Published: 2020-03-18 | Updated: 2021-06-17

Vulnerability identifier: #VU11317

Vulnerability risk: High

CVSSv3.1: 9.4 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H/E:H/RL:O/RC:C]

CVE-ID: CVE-2018-7600

CWE-ID: CWE-94

Exploitation vector: Network

Exploit availability: Yes

Vulnerable software:
Drupal
Web applications / CMS

Vendor: Drupal

Description
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to compromise vulnerable system.

The vulnerability exists due to unspecified error within multiple subsystems of Drupal installation. A remote unauthenticated attacker can execute arbitrary code on the target system.

Successful exploitation of the vulnerability may allow an attacker to compromise vulnerable system.

Mitigation
Update to version 7.58 or 8.5.1.

Vulnerable software versions

Drupal: 8.5.0, 8.4.0 - 8.4.5, 8.3.0 - 8.3.8, 8.2.0 - 8.2.8, 8.1.0 - 8.1.10, 8.0.0 - 8.0.6, 7.0 - 7.57, 6.0 - 6.38
